Output 30c8d97473418c8dbd3c6bcb5afd62b72645074f21c1bf59c514a5f681ce3e21:29

value
1040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350ac3fddc1f77529fb09ffb32944d248d12f27d OP_EQUAL
address
36XUdiZ2vG4fsRCptHb6G7x1J6PbpfgMAy
transaction
30c8d97473418c8dbd3c6bcb5afd62b72645074f21c1bf59c514a5f681ce3e21
spent
true